Northwest Airlines forms e-ticketing agreement with KLM

Airline Industry Information, May 8, 2003

AIRLINE INDUSTRY INFORMATION-(C)1997-2003 M2 COMMUNICATIONS LTD

Northwest Airlines and KLM Royal Dutch Airlines have formed a transatlantic interline electronic ticketing agreement.

The service - to be introduced during the first half of June 2003 - will enable customers with itineraries on both airlines to use a single e-ticket issued by either carrier. Previously, passengers were required to obtain a separate e-ticket for each carrier or obtain a paper ticket.

Northwest Airlines also has e-ticketing agreements with Continental Airlines, Alaska Airlines, Horizon Air and Delta Air Lines.
